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/5] drm/i915: Consider object pinned if any VMA is pinned

On pe, 2015-04-24 at 13:29 +0100, Chris Wilson wrote:
> On Fri, Apr 24, 2015 at 03:09:39PM +0300, Joonas Lahtinen wrote:
> > Do not skip special GGTT views when considering whether an object
> > is pinned or not.
> > 
> > Wrong behaviour was introduced in;
> > 
> > commit ec7adb6ee79c8c9fe64d63ad638a31cd62e55515
> > Author: Joonas Lahtinen <joonas.lahtinen@linux.intel.com>
> > Date:   Mon Mar 16 14:11:13 2015 +0200
> > 
> >     drm/i915: Do not use ggtt_view with (aliasing) PPGTT
> > 
> > Cc: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ch>
> > Cc: Tvrtko Ursulin <tvrtko.ursulin@linux.intel.com>
> > Signed-off-by: Joonas Lahtinen <joonas.lahtinen@linux.intel.com>
> 
> The function is obsolete. Please review the patches to remove the
> callsite with more explicit vma management.

I do not call it myself at all, and I'm hesitant to change all the code
calling function just because I slipped code to function where it didn't
belong and now needs to be removed :P

I would leave this to the cleanup phase where all VMA related code was
agreed to be moved to its own file. I put it to my TODO list as it's not
related to the partial view series. Just to get this series out ASAP.

Regards, Joonas
